Analysis

The Los Angeles Kings defeated the Anaheim Ducks 6–1 on Dec 27, 2025, a decisive 5-goal win.

Los Angeles Kings generated 2.99 expected goals to Anaheim Ducks's 2.5 — the run of play matched the result, with Los Angeles Kings earning the better chances as well as the goals; by expected goals it was close to a coin flip.

Alex Laferriere led all skaters with a Game Score of 2.35 on 3 goals, 5 shots on goal.

Anton Forsberg stopped 25 of 26, worth -0.57 goals saved above expected.
